If I remeber correctly it randomly gives extra capture items but they still have the same percentages.
So the idea is more drops gives more chances for a good drop. It doesn't increase the rates on everything. Just gives you more cap rewards and kinda does affect the rates at which you can get items that rates are increased when a monster is captured, since it gives you more cap reward items.
Makes sense? So it doesn't increase the percentages of each item individually, it just runs the check on how many items you find more times? That makes more sense. Thanks guys! Reaperfan wrote: So it doesn't increase the percentages of each item individually, it just runs the check on how many items you find more times? It affects the number of capture rewards blue box. Thus, more chances of getting an item that is affected by capturing a monster.
